1. Commodity hedging in volatile markets

For companies operating in the agricultural sector—like coffee cooperatives or grain producers—market turmoil is a constant concern. Prices on global exchanges can swing within minutes on the back of weather news, trade decisions, or logistic disturbances. With AI-driven simulation, a trading desk can test how a sudden drop in coffee futures or a volatility spike would impact their current hedged positions.

Practical scenarios might include:

  • Predicting the effect of an overnight freeze on coffee crops using AI-driven supply models and market overlays.
  • Measuring outcomes of trade tensions between major producing and consuming countries.
  • Quantifying the potential portfolio loss if logistics bottlenecks delay product delivery.

2. Cash flow stability for energy suppliers

Energy markets are famously unpredictable. A minor shift in natural gas supply, unexpected geopolitics, or regulation changes can shake pricing structures. AI scenario simulations let risk teams see, in advance, how these shocks would impact operating cash flows, margin calls, and ultimately, company solvency.

Energy firms using platforms like UHEDGE employ stress simulation to:

  • Visualize exposure if a sudden spike in oil prices triggers additional margin calls on derivative positions.
  • Anticipate liquidity requirements if new environmental regulations disrupt fuel supply chains.
  • Assess how multi-asset price shocks could impact their full value chain (from production to distribution).

3. Supply chain resilience in manufacturing and consumer goods

Manufacturers and consumer goods firms face risk both from upstream suppliers and downstream distributors. AI-powered stress simulation offers a panoramic view. A sudden disruption (say, raw material price jumps or a supplier bankruptcy) can be run through digital models to reveal vulnerable links—and recommend action before shipments are halted or costs overrun.

Some common stress test scenarios:

  • Simulating the impact of a 25% price jump in steel or plastic on unit economics and inventory value.
  • Testing for payment defaults downstream if a major retailer unexpectedly closes locations.
  • Understanding cascading effects in global supply chains from regulatory or currency shocks.

4. FX and interest rate exposure for mid-size financial institutions

Banks and medium-sized lenders live with interest rate and FX fluctuations. When markets lurch, institutions can find themselves on the wrong side of costly swaps, options, or loans. AI-enhanced stress testing helps these organizations map their risk profile and simulate portfolio impacts from sudden hikes or policy shifts.

For example, users of digital treasury suites like UHEDGE can:

  • Generate custom scenarios: "What happens if the central bank raises rates by 200 basis points overnight?"
  • See the ripple effects across derivative books, loan portfolios, and liquidity reserves.
  • Monitor regulatory capital ratios under extreme but plausible conditions.

Frequently asked questions

What is scenario stress testing with AI?

Scenario stress testing with AI refers to the process of using artificial intelligence to simulate extreme market events, operational disruptions, or sudden shocks in various business environments. AI models build detailed scenarios by analyzing vast datasets and historical patterns. The goal is to uncover hidden vulnerabilities and prepare effective strategies before an actual crisis occurs.

How can AI improve stress testing?

AI can analyze more data, faster and with greater accuracy than traditional approaches. By automating scenario creation and risk assessment, AI provides deeper insights and real-time results for decision-makers. This leads to more timely actions and improved financial stability, even during unpredictable events.

What industries use AI for stress testing?

Industries that face high levels of volatility—such as agribusiness, energy, manufacturing, and financial services—are early adopters of AI-powered stress simulation. Any sector exposed to rapid price changes, policy shifts, or global supply chain disruptions will benefit from this approach. Platforms like UHEDGE have demonstrated strong applications across these fields.

Are AI-based stress tests accurate?

AI-based stress tests are highly accurate when they combine robust quantitative modeling, high-quality data, and continuous learning. While no model can predict every future outcome, AI-enhanced platforms improve both precision and reliability in mapping complex risk landscapes and anticipating outlier scenarios.

How does stress testing help businesses?

Stress testing empowers organizations to anticipate extreme events, measure potential financial impacts, and protect their margins through smart planning. It helps leaders move from a reactive to a proactive stance and supports a disciplined, data-backed approach to governance, operational agility, and long-term profitability.
